AWARD-WINNING LAUREN DAIGLE TO EMBARK ON HER FIRST HEADLINE TOUR TITLED "A NIGHT WITH LAUREN DAIGLE" FROM OCTOBER 14-30

TOUR PRESENTED BY CURE INTERNATIONAL TO FEATURE SPECIAL GUEST PERFORMER CHRIS MCCLARNEY

(June 16, 2016) - Centricity Music artist Lauren Daigle, will embark on her first headline tour titled "A Night with Lauren Daigle," with special guest Chris McClarney, in support of her recently released HOW CAN IT BE DELUXE EDITION. The tour, sponsored by CURE International, is scheduled from October 14-30, beginning in Memphis, Tennessee. Daigle, who is currently opening on the Hillsong UNITED Empires tour, has been on a whirlwind year since her debut award-winning album, HOW CAN IT BE, was released.

Says Daigle, "I am so pumped to share that I will be headlining my very first tour in the fall! My deepest desire for these nights is that God would shake the foundation of what we know of Him, and expand our revelation of who He is. I want people to feel like they can drink from the water of Life, rest in His presence, and leave refueled and empowered to fulfill all that He has in store. She continues, "I'm partnering with CURE International because of my love for the medical field and missions. I'm also elated to announce that Chris McClarney will be joining me for the evening."

Daigle received her first GRAMMY® nomination earlier this year for "Best Contemporary Christian Music Album" at the 58th GRAMMY® Awards; and took home the 2016 Billboard Music Award for "Top Christian Album." She has won three Dove Awards (nominated for four) -- "New Artist of the Year," "Song of the Year" ("How Can It Be") and "Pop Contemporary Album of the Year," and was awarded this year's K-LOVE Fan Awards for "Artist of the Year" and "Female Artist of the Year"; in addition to the 2015 K-LOVE Fan Award for "Worship Song of the Year" ("How Can It Be").

Daigle has steadily positioned herself at the top of the charts since her debut full-length album release. Her singles "How Can It Be" and "First" both reached #1 on the iTunes Christian Songs Chart and #1 on the Christian Digital Tracks Chart, with "First" also reaching #1 on the NCA radio chart. "Trust in You," which earned Daigle her first No. 1 single spot on Billboard's Hot Christian Songs chart in March 2016, continues to hold its top spot after 13 consecutive weeks, while also remaining in the #1 position on the NCA radio chart for nine consecutive weeks. The song currently holds the #1 position on the iTunes Christian Songs Chart and the Christian Digital Tracks Chart.

HOW CAN IT BE has logged more than five weeks at #1 on Billboard's Top Christian Albums chart, and premiered in the Top 30 on the Billboard 200. HOW CAN IT BE also reached #1 on the iTunes Christian Gospel Top Albums Chart with more than 320,500 album sales and 813,000 track sales, positioning her as the fastest-selling new artist in Contemporary Christian music in the past decade. Daigle has had over 76 million YouTube and Vevo views, with approximately 250,000 subscribers. For "How Can It Be" alone, she has had more than 15 million views.

About CHRIS MCCLARNEY:
Chris McClarney's powerful anthem "Your Love Never Fails" has become one of the most popular songs in America's churches as reported in the TOP 25 of CCLI, and is a #1 song on the Billboard Christian chart. Chris recently partnered with Jesus Culture music recording his debut live album "Everything and Nothing Less." The live album features nine new songs recorded live at the 2015 Jesus Culture Sacramento conference.

About CURE International:
CURE International is a Christian health care network that operates charitable hospitals and pediatric surgical programs in 30 countries worldwide. Patients experience the life-changing message of God's love for them, receiving surgical treatment regardless of gender, religion, or ethnicity. Since 1998, CURE International has had more than 2.9 million patient visits, provided over 218,000 life-changing surgeries, and trained over 8,100 medical professionals.
